As a school-based SLP, the candidate will have the following responsibilities:

  • Accept referrals and screen children
  • Prepare written reports, interpret student evaluations, and develop Individualized Educational Programs (IEP).
  • Schedule therapy sessions for students in groups or on a one-on-one basis
  • Meet with parents to review student progress, reassess needs, etc.
  • Collaborate with parents, caregivers, teaching staff, and administrators.
  • Work closely with other members of program staff to develop curricula.
  • Make and/or recommend appropriate environmental modifications needed to facilitate student experience.
